On Fri, Apr 15, 2016 at 8:48 PM, Feike Steenbergen <feikesteenbergen@gmail.com> wrote: > pg_get_functiondef(oid) does not return the PARALLEL indicators. > > Attached a small patch to have pg_get_functiondef actually add these > indicators, using commit 7aea8e4f2 (pg_dump.c) as a guide. > > The logic is the same as with the volatility: we only append non-default > indicators. +1 for a good catch. Your patch is correct. -- Michael
